1. Improve HappinessIn a simulation video game based on actual football games, the most direct way to improve your happiness in Road to Glory in NACC 26 is to increase the coach’s trust in you and the coach’s happiness.
Coach TrustCoach Trust is one of the easier attributes to increase, and you can get it by starting and performing well in games. If you don’t make the starting lineup, you can also achieve this goal through daily training.
In the practice mini-games provided to you, there are three medals: gold, silver and bronze, which will give you different trust points. Bronze gives you 50 points, silver gives you 150 points and gold gives you 300 points. So please work hard to get the gold medal.
As your coach’s trust in you gradually increases, your chances of becoming a starter will increase, and you will also have the opportunity to unlock some additional gameplay perks, such as customizing call voice prompts and setting some popular routes.
When your coach’s trust is the same as another player on the team, it will trigger Position Battles, where you need to compete against them in a series of three practice mini-games, and win two games to increase your ranking. But be aware that you will also be punished accordingly if you fail.
Not only that, when some players transfer, graduate or participate in the draft, your ranking will also rise, but this is very random. So relying on your own ability to improve your ranking is the most stable and reliable way.
Coach HappinessThis evaluation system is newly added by EA College Football 26, and its evaluation criteria are not fixed like Coach Trust. It will be more capricious, because its main variable factor is your off-field behavior.
For example, some decisions you make during the key period of the season, such as some responsible decisions, will boost the morale of the entire team, thereby improving coach happiness; but some rude or perfunctory characters will have the opposite effect.
In addition, your daily training is not up to standard or you do not show strong leadership in Weekly Agenda, which will also affect the decline of coach happiness.
This happiness will directly affect the speed at which Coach Trust increases or decreases. If it is higher, your trust will accumulate faster; if it is lower, they will lose faster, and you will need to spend more time to improve it and more NACC 26 Coins to improve the players’ strength.

How Can You Get A Lot Of Legendary Runes?If you want to get a lot of Rare or Magic runes, you need Tribute of Harmony. We can insert Tribute of Harmony into Kurast Undercity and let the final boss of the dungeon drop runes for us.
Please note that Tribute of Harmony drops from Pit. If you want to get a lot of them, you can try to find them there. In addition, Lair Bosses will also drop a lot of Rare or Magic runes, which is also a way to get runes.
Now, here comes the trick! Once you have accumulated a lot of Rare and Magic runes after completing the quest, you can go to Alchemist to transform these runes.
Don’t underestimate this Transmutation function, because it involves transforming three identical Rare runes and creating a new Rare rune with a probability of up to 85%. This process has a 15% chance of dropping a random Legendary Rune for you. Doesn’t it sound exciting?
In simple terms, you can convert Magic Runes in your pocket, and each time there will be a 15% chance of generating a Rare Rune. After that, convert the accumulated Rare Runes again, and there will also be a 15% chance of getting a Legendary Rune.
Repeat this cycle many times until you use up these runes, and you will get a lot of Legendary Runes. If you are lucky enough, you may find some runes worth hundreds of millions of gold.

Uber Duriel Summoning MaterialsBefore we start running Duriel, we should understand the basics of Diablo 4 boss ladder.
First, you need to do Whispers to get Varshan Body Parts in order to summon Varshan. Defeating Echo of Varshan will drop Mucus-Slick Eggs, one of two items required to summon Duriel.
The other is to do Helltides to get Living Steel, which we will use to summon Grigoire. Grigoire drops Shards of Agony, another item necessary to summon Duriel.
How To Farm Varshan Body Parts?You can find Whispers on the map by their icons. Their help text will give you an objective and how many Grim Favors they will give you.
Turn in 10 Grim Favors to get Whisper Caches at Tree of Whispers. Opening the cache will give you random Varshan Body Parts. You need to collect all 4 Varshan Body Parts to summon Varshan.
It should be noted that Malignant Hearts will only drop from chests obtained from World Tier 4. Therefore, I recommend against farming Varshan summon items in World Tier 3.
In Season 3, there are 4 ways to farm Varshan efficiently.
Arcane TremorsMy favorite method is to farm Arcane Tremors when they are available, which you can do once an hour. You need to interact with 3 Obelisks, which will drop Elemental Cores. Defeat 100 Constructs in the area and use 3 Elemental Cores to spawn Herald of Malphas. Defeating 100 Constructs and Herald of Malphas can be accomplished at the same time, as it will spawn waves of enemies.
This method of farming Whisper Caches only takes about 3 minutes and yields a total of 11 Grim Favors. As an added bonus, you also get Igneous Cores needed to generate Uber Malpha.
PVP AreaThe next farming method is to take advantage of the red PVP areas. There are two separate areas on the map, each with a Whisper to defeat Seething Abomination.
First, you need to go to PVP area and find Abomination walking in a circle around the center of the area. This boss can be powerful, but if you’re willing to spend $1 on decent gear, he’ll probably only take about 30 seconds to defeat. Defeating two Seething Abominations will also net you 10 Grim Favors in about 3 minutes.
Whisper DungeonsOur next farming method is completing Whisper dungeons, which will provide 5 Grim Favors for each completed dungeon.
This can be a little tricky because the completion time of the dungeon depends entirely on the objectives. Typically, dungeons with the objective of killing all enemies may take the longest to complete. For this reason, it is recommended to use a Speed Farming Build for your class and stack as much movement speed as possible.
Grotesque DebtorsOther ways to grow Varshan Body Parts are to look for Grotesque Debtors. These special enemies will have a chance to spawn when you or anyone near you complete Whisper objectives. You just need to keep an eye out for this symbol on the minimap. It means Grotesque Debtors are spawning at that location.
Farming Living SteelHelltides is a special event in Diablo 4 where two areas spawn higher level enemies. Enemies in Helltides drop a special currency called Aberrant Cinders during the event. Aberrant Cinders will be used to open new treasure chests that spawn around the area.
Note that dying in Helltides will cause you to lose half of Aberrant Cinders you collected.
Once you have collected 275 Aberrant Cinders, you can find a Living Steel Chest. Each Living Steel Chest provides 5 Living Steel, while other chests only drop 1 Living Steel. Each area has 1 Living Steel Chest, which means you can get a total of 10 Living Steel per run.
Overall, the best farming strategy is to prioritize collecting two Living Steel Chests from Helltides every hour. Whisper can also be farmed while you’re waiting for the next Helltides to spawn.
After completing Helltides, follow the priority list of Arcane Tremors and Seething Abomination first, then use the remaining time to run Whisper dungeons until the next Helltide appears.
Running Uber BossesNext up is running Uber Bosses. I recommend being properly equipped and fully upgraded before attempting these.
GrigoireGrigoire is located in Hall of the Penitent in Dry Steppes Region. You need 5 Living Steel to summon Grigoire. They usually drop 1-2 Shards of Agony per run.
VarshanVarshan is located next to Tree of Whispers in Malignant Burrow. Because summoning Varshan requires collecting all 4 Body Parts, if your Body Parts are unbalanced, you can exchange them by trading Varshan Body Parts for Malignant Cache at Alchemist.
Defeating Varshan again has a chance to drop 1-2 Mucus-Slick Eggs. After completing each run of Grigoire or Varshan, you can use Reset Dungeon button on the right side of the map.
DurielTo find out how many times you can summon Uber Duriel, check your Mucus-Slick Eggs and Shards of Agony and divide the lowest number of summoned items by 2.
To get the most out of beating Duriel, I recommend that you create or find an entire team of players, which means you have more chances of running Uber Duriel.
Uber Duriel always drops 925 gear, which is a great place to find the best gear. But the main reason to grow Duriel is Uber Uniques, but there are some regular Uniques as well. Tibault’s Will, X’Fal’s Corroded Signet, Godslayer Crown, and Flickerstep are popular choices for different builds.

Intro To Alpha GearAs a default feature, Alpha Gear enables users to store gear and skills in various configurations.
Subsequently, users can allocate a gear configuration and two skill configurations to a specific build. Additionally, outfit assignment is possible for each build. Hotkeys can then be designated for each configuration, facilitating the instantaneous application of the associated gear, skills, and outfit upon activation.
Some individuals may inquire about the similarity between Alpha Gear and ESO's Armory system. While there are parallels, the vanilla Armory system permits the preservation and interchange of builds, albeit with some limitations. Access to the Armory station or an Armory assistant is required, and navigating through the dialogue swiftly, especially in group dungeons, can pose challenges.
Notably, Alpha Gear surpasses these restrictions by offering unrestricted build creation, allowing users to generate numerous configurations according to their preferences.
